Angela, use a smaller needle for the ribbon and check your tension, it looks a little tight and tight tension and too big a needle is affecting the ribbon
And the embroidery thread is not best for this sewing but at least bobbin thread should be of similar weight, if not it could also cause the puckering. Then should make test with smaller needle, tension adjustment and stitch lenght.

FYI I worked in a sewing factory and we had a L bracket underneath our machine to hold elastic and then it would come off the roll up to your foot and then you could just takeoff and sew like crazy. I was thinking that you could do the same thing with rolls of ribbon it shouldn’t take much to attach a L bracket and attach it underneath and we always used a clothes pin to hold the ribbon on the bracket . Just think how fast you could put ribbon on!! A magnet guide would hold your ribbon in place.

Hey Angela! The tutus turned out even more beautiful than I expected! By the way, I have the same machine and I noticed you are using your hand with the knee lift to raise your presser foot. Not sure if you know but there is a hand lift/switch on the back left of the machine right above the needle. It may be more convenient and more what you're used to with other sewing machines.
